F.L. Storch's 1862 oil painting, "Grev Otto af Oldenborg og det oldenborgske horn," depicts a dramatic scene from Danish history. The artwork shows Count Otto of Oldenburg, a figure of great historical importance, riding his white horse through a dense forest. He holds aloft the Oldenborg horn, a symbol of the dynasty's power, while a woman, perhaps representing Denmark, reaches out to him, her hand outstretched. The detailed rendering of the figures, the horse's dynamic pose, and the lush forest backdrop make this a highly evocative and historically significant work, now housed at the SMK - Statens Museum for Kunst.
